Athematic Past Progressive Indicative Middle and Passive
Introduction
Some verbs form the past progressive indicative middle and passive without a theme vowel. Thus, they are called athematic:
| ἐ/ or L/ | BASE | progressive aspect marker | /μην /μεθα /σο /σθε /το /ντο |
For instance:
| ἐ/δυνα/μην > ἐδυνάμην | I was able |
| ἐ/θι/θε/τo > ἐτίθετο | she/he/it was being put, placed |
| ἐ/δεικ/νυ/μεθα > ἐδεικνύμεθα | we were being shown |
Most verbs in this category are /μι verbs.
